Compare the rivalry schools - Allen University and College of Charleston.

Allen University is a Private, 4-years school located in Columbia, SC and College of Charleston is a Public, 4-years school located in Charleston, SC.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• Allen University (43.36% acceptance rate) is tighter than College of Charleston (75.69% acceptance rate) to get in.
  • College of Charleston (10,885 students) is larger than Allen University (657 students).
  • College of Charleston has more expensive tuition & fees of $36,858 than Allen University($14,304).
  • College of Charleston has more full-time faculties of 511 faculties than Allen University(41 facluties).
